BINT 4390 - International Policies&Reltns

Institution:
University of the Incarnate Word
Subject:
International Business
Description:
Concentrated course offered in a host country to expose students to current trade policy issues and international relations. May include Embassy speakers, visits to factories, seminars with trade specialists or study- abroad experiences. Fee. Prerequisite: BINT 3331
